He is one of the most photographed teenagers in the world but it appears it still doesn’t take much to impersonate Justin Bieber.
With a pair of sunglasses, a hoody, some fake tattoos and a few bodyguards, 16-year-old Jeremy Frost managed to convince die-hard Bieber fans he was the real deal.
A hoard of delighted, screaming girls can be seen posing up for pictures and hugging the imposter in a clip uploaded to YouTube which has already been viewed more than 440,000 times.
Imposter: Jeremy Frost, 16, pictured left, decided to attempt the prank after being told he looked like singer Justin Bieber, 19, pictured right
Jeremy, who has been told he resembles the pop singer, decided to pull the prank with the help of his friend and brother, who have their own YouTube channel called Three Amigos Comedy, to see what sort of reaction he received.
Hours before the real Justin Bieber, 19, was due to perform in Boston, Jeremy went on a tour of the city complete with fake paparazzi and bodyguards.
To make sure he looked the part, he wore Bieber’s typical outfit of a baseball cap, white hoody, baggy jeans and lots of bling.
Delighted Bieber fans couldn’t believe their luck and happily posed for photos, asked him for autographs, hugs and kisses, with no idea they weren’t meeting the famous teen.
